The Apple G5 1.6, also known as the A-1047, made improvements in performance as well as design over its predecessor; the Apple G3. The tower computer is formed out of anodized aluminum alloy with a unique mesh front for additional cooling. The G5 series debuted on June 23, 2003 running the MacOS X 10.2.7 and was advertised as the first desktop computer to utilize a 64-bit processor, allowing for higher processor speeds and better multitasking.

Apple has manufactured several different laptop models; none of them can directly connect to another via standard serial cables. Vintage (pre-1998) Apple laptops used a proprietary version of the serial connection, Apple desktop bus (ADB) connectors.

The Apple A1181 laptop, commonly known as the 2 gigahertz MacBook, comes with the Leopard operating system that includes the option of an administrator password to unlock the administrator account. If you happen to forget your password, you must use the installation disc that came with the laptop. Changing your administrator password can be accomplished if FileVault is not enabled, as FileVault is a encryption tool that prevents all users from accessing your Home folder. Your Home folder will be erased if you attempt to change your administrator password while FileVault is enabled.

Apple released the PowerBook G3 series of laptops between 1997 and 2000. They were Apple's third official generation of laptops (hence "G3"). The G3 series was replaced in 2000 by the next generation's G4 models.

To turn your Apple laptop into a media powerhouse, you can easily connect it to your TV with an inexpensive adapter (around $20) and the proper cables. Check the back of your TV to find out what kind of audio and video connections it supports. Some high-definition TVs (HDTVs) have Digital Video Interface (DVI) ports, which feature three rows of 8 pins with a blade next to them. Some HDTVs have High-Definition Multimedia Interface (HDMI) ports, which look like skinny trapezoids. Some have both. Older TVs may have S-video ports, which are circular and colored yellow. If the keys on your Apple laptop computer are becoming worn out, you should replace them. The keycaps are connected to the board with scissor-like parts that push the key down and back up when pressed. Both the scissor and the cap should be replaced. The exact type of replacement cap and scissor you need depends on the type of model laptop you have. Some keys use plastic scissors, while others use metal ones. Depending on the type of scissors, how you replace the keys is different.
